  1. Are you running Windows 8? I have Saitek controller and have had similar problems. I believe it has something to do with clicking out of the FSX window or clicking on your tool bar. For some reason it causes the contrôlée to disconnect and lose variable different functions. Also Win 8 has menu you are which manages USB port power and may disconnect you decvice as well. Finally if you run Norton, there are some power management setting that cause ports or programs to pause if there is in action (I.e. Your're just sitting there flying and don't change a view or interact with FSX). Once program pauses in this manner and you re-clique in the window to restart, you lose functionality on you control device.
